Netflix Has Shared Their Three-Part Stranger Things Season 5 Release Schedule
Netflix announced the episode count for Stranger Things season 5. Four episodes will be released on November 26th, 2025, and three episodes will come out on December 25th, 2025. Then, the series finale will be released on December 31st, 2025. Netflix also shared that each new batch of episodes will be available at 5 p.m. P.S.T.
Before Netflix's announcement as part of their live Tudum event on May 31st, 2025, there was a rumor that the streaming service would put out Stranger Things season 5 in three parts. While there was a report that this was false, it ended up being true. What Time Can Fans Expect To Watch Stranger Things Season 5's Three Parts?
- Canada: 5 p.m. P.S.T. (Vancouver)
- USA: 5 p.m. P.S.T. (Los Angeles), 8 p.m. E.S.T. (New York)
- United Kingdom: 1:00 a.m. GMT (London)
- France: 2:00 a.m. CET (Paris)
- Italy: 2:00 a.m. CET (Rome)
